アンケート結果をExcelで回収したものの、複数のファイルに分かれてしまい、集計作業に時間がかかっていませんか?手作業でコピー&ペーストするのは非効率ですし、データ量が増えるとミスのリスクも高まります。
Excelの機能を活用すれば、簡単に複数のアンケートファイルを1枚のシートに統合できます。本記事では、その方法を詳しく解説します。
複数のファイルを1つのシートに統合する方法
Excelでは、以下の方法で複数のアンケートデータを1つのシートに統合できます。
- Power Queryを活用する方法
- VBA(マクロ)を使う方法
- 手作業で効率的に統合する方法
ここでは、それぞれの方法を詳しく説明します。
Power Queryを活用する方法(おすすめ)
Power Queryを使用すると、手間をかけずに複数のファイルを統合できます。
- Power Queryを開く
- [データ]タブ → [データの取得と変換] → [フォルダーから] を選択
- アンケートデータが入ったフォルダーを選択
- [ファイルの組み合わせ]を選び、ファイルのプレビューを確認
- 不要な列を削除し、データを整える
- 必要な列だけ残し、不要なデータは削除
- 統合したデータをExcelシートに読み込む
- [閉じて読み込む]をクリックして統合完了!
VBA(マクロ)を使う方法
VBAを使えば、ボタン1つで複数のファイルを統合できます。
Sub MergeFiles()
Dim ws As Worksheet
Dim wb As Workbook
Dim FileDialog As FileDialog
Dim FilePath As String
Dim LastRow As Long
Set FileDialog = Application.FileDialog(msoFileDialogFilePicker)
FileDialog.AllowMultiSelect = True
If FileDialog.Show = -1 Then
For Each FilePath In FileDialog.SelectedItems
Set wb = Workbooks.Open(FilePath)
Set ws = wb.Sheets(1)
LastRow = ThisWorkbook.Sheets(1).Cells(Rows.Count, 1).End(xlUp).Row + 1
ws.UsedRange.Copy ThisWorkbook.Sheets(1).Cells(LastRow, 1)
wb.Close False
Next FilePath
End If
End Sub
上記のマクロを実行すれば、複数のアンケートファイルを簡単に統合できます。
手作業で統合する場合の効率的な方法
手作業で統合する場合も、以下の手順で効率化できます。
- 全データをコピーし、まとめるシートに貼り付ける
- [Ctrl] + [矢印キー]を活用し、大量データの操作をスムーズに
- [フィルター]機能を使い、重複データを整理する
注意点
- データフォーマットの統一
- アンケートファイルの列名やデータの並びが統一されているか確認しましょう。
- 重複データの処理
- データを統合する際に、[重複の削除]機能を活用し、重複データを取り除くことが重要です。
- 誤ったファイルの統合を避ける
- ファイル名や内容をチェックし、誤ったデータを統合しないように注意しましょう。
結論
Excelを使えば、複数のアンケートファイルを簡単に統合できます。
- Power Queryを使えば、クリック操作で自動的に統合
- **VBA(マクロ)**を使えば、ボタン1つで一括処理
- 手作業でもショートカットを駆使すれば効率化可能
適切な方法を選んで、作業時間を短縮し、正確なデータ分析を行いましょう!
コメント